What Are Crypto Coin Casinos? Crypto coin casinos are online gambling sites that accept cryptocurrencies as a form of payment. Instead of using dollars, euros, or pounds, these platforms enable users to fund their accounts and place bets using digital coins. This shift towards blockchain-based currency stems from several advantages that cryptocurrency offers, including faster transactions, reduced fees, and stronger privacy protections. Unlike regular online casinos, crypto coin casinos typically operate on decentralized or semi-decentralized systems, which means they can offer more transparency, provably fair gaming, and less interference from third-party financial institutions. Some crypto casinos are entirely crypto-based, while others allow both cryptocurrency and fiat deposits, giving players a flexible choice depending on their preferences. Payment Methods and Wallet Integration One of the most crucial aspects when choosing a crypto coin casino is the support for your preferred payment methods. Since the ecosystem is still evolving, different casinos support different cryptocurrencies or wallets. Supported Cryptocurrencies: Most crypto casinos accept Bitcoin due to its popularity and network security. Ethereum and Litecoin are also widely supported, and some platforms expand options to include Ripple (XRP), Bitcoin Cash (BCH), Dogecoin (DOGE), and stablecoins like USDT or USDC. Wallet Compatibility: Players should use compatible wallets—software or hardware—that support the chosen coins. Many casinos integrate with popular wallets such as MetaMask, Trust Wallet, or Ledger devices. Deposit Process: Usually simple, deposits involve sending cryptocurrency from your wallet to the casino’s wallet address. Transaction confirmation times can vary based on network congestion and currency. Withdrawals: Withdrawal requests send crypto back to your wallet. These are often processed faster than fiat withdrawals but may be subject to minimum limits or fees. Before committing, check for any hidden fees or conversion restrictions. Also, ensure the casino has clear procedures for handling lost or delayed funds, as cryptocurrency transactions are irreversible.
